相关疑难解决方法(0)

如何在Android中显示Toast?

我有一个可以拉起来的滑块,然后它会显示一张地图.我可以上下移动滑块来隐藏或显示地图.当地图在前面时,我可以处理该地图上的触摸事件.每当我触摸时,a AsyncTask会被启动,它会下载一些数据并生成一个Toast显示数据的数据.虽然我在触摸事件上启动任务但是没有显示吐司,直到我关闭滑块.当滑块关闭并且不再显示地图时,会Toast出现.

有任何想法吗?

好了开始任务

编辑:

public boolean onTouchEvent(MotionEvent event, MapView mapView){ 
    if (event.getAction() == 1) {
        new TestTask(this).execute();
        return true;            
    }else{
        return false;
    }
 }
Run Code Online (Sandbox Code Playgroud)

onPostExecute祝酒

Toast.makeText(app.getBaseContext(),(String)data.result, 
                Toast.LENGTH_SHORT).show();
Run Code Online (Sandbox Code Playgroud)

在新的TestTask(this),这是一个参考,MapOverlay而不是MapActivity,所以这是问题.

android toast android-asynctask android-mapview

433
推荐指数
13
解决办法
101万
查看次数

检查EditText是否为空.

EditTexts在Android中有5个用户输入.我想知道我是否可以有一个方法来检查所有5,EditTexts如果它们是null.有没有办法做到这一点?

android android-edittext

208
推荐指数
10
解决办法
42万
查看次数